Master Precise Language for Events - Bring Your Stories to Life

You will learn to transform vague event descriptions into vivid, engaging narratives that make readers feel like they experienced everything firsthand.


What You'll Learn

You replace vague words with vivid verbs and specific nouns.
You create clear mental images using concrete sensory language details.
You organize events with precise time transitions and sequencing words.
You develop engaging narratives that help readers experience your events.
